Charizard (Japanese: リザードン Lizardon) is a playable Pokémon in Pokémon UNITE. It became available as a playable character on July 21, 2021.

Abilities

Passive Ability

UNITE Blaze.png
Blaze
もうか Raging Flames
Description

When the Pokémon is at half HP or less, its critical-hit rate is increased.

Basic Attack

UNITE Attack.png Damage category: Physical (as a basic attack)
Damage category: Physical (as a boosted attack)
Description

Deals continual damage. Deals additional damage to opposing Pokémon that have been burned by the user's moves. Increases in range when the user evolves.


Moveset

Move slot 1

UNITE Flame Burst.png Flame Burst
はじけるほのお
Flame Burst
Learned at Lv. 1 or 3
Cooldown: 6 seconds
Upgrades into Flamethrower or Fire Punch
UNITE Skill Label Ranged.png Ranged Description
Attacks with a bursting flame. When this move hits, it leaves opposing Pokémon burned and increases the user's movement speed for a short time.
UNITE Flamethrower.png Flamethrower
かえんほうしゃ
Flamethrower
Learned at Lv. 5
Cooldown: 5.5 seconds
Upgrades into Flamethrower+ at Lv. 11
UNITE Skill Label Ranged.png Ranged Description
Attacks with an intense blast of fire. When this move hits, it leaves opposing Pokémon burned and increases the user's movement speed for a short time.

Upgrade: Increases this move's damage and the damage caused by burning.

UNITE Fire Punch.png Fire Punch
ほのおのパンチ
Flame Punch
Learned at Lv. 5
Cooldown: 8 seconds
Upgrades into Fire Punch+ at Lv. 11
UNITE Skill Label Melee.png Melee Description
Has the user punch with a fiery fist, dealing damage and shoving opposing Pokémon when it hits. Also leaves the opposing Pokémon it shoves burned.

Upgrade: Reduces this move's cooldown every time a basic attack hits.

Move slot 2

UNITE Fire Spin.png Fire Spin
ほのおのうず
Flame Swirl
Learned at Lv. 1 or 3
Cooldown: 10 seconds
Upgrades into Fire Blast or Flare Blitz
UNITE Skill Label Area.png Area Description
Encircles opposing Pokémon in the area of effect in a vortex of fire. After this move hits, it deals damage over time and decreases the movement speed of opposing Pokémon for a short time.
UNITE Fire Blast.png Fire Blast
だいもんじ
Daimonji
Learned at Lv. 7
Cooldown: 6.5 seconds
Upgrades into Fire Blast+ at Lv. 13
UNITE Skill Label Area.png Area Description
Blasts intense, all-consuming fire, dealing damage over time to opposing Pokémon while the flames continue to burn on the ground and decreasing the movement speed of opposing Pokémon for a short time.

Upgrade: Increases damage dealt by this move.

UNITE Flare Blitz.png Flare Blitz
フレアドライブ
Flare Drive
Learned at Lv. 7
Cooldown: 10 seconds
Upgrades into Flare Blitz+ at Lv. 13
UNITE Skill Label Sure Hit.png Sure Hit Description
Has the user charge forward cloaked in fire, throwing opposing Pokémon. Also grants the user a shield.

Upgrade: Also decreases the movement speed of opposing Pokémon for a short time when they are thrown by this move.

Unite Move

UNITE Seismic Slam.png Seismic Slam
アースクラッシャー
Earth Crusher
Learned at Lv. 9
UNITE Skill Label Sure Hit.png Sure Hit Description
Has the user grab a Pokémon from the opposing team and slam it onto the ground from the air. For a set amount of time afterward, the user can move freely over obstacles. While this Unite Move is being used, the user's basic attacks deal increased damage and leave opposing Pokémon burned. In addition, when the user deals damage to an opposing Pokémon, the user recovers HP.
